About the Team
Our Grid Technologies division enables a reliable, sustainable, and digital grid. The power grid is the backbone of the energy transition. Siemens Energy offers a leading portfolio and solutions in HVDC transmission, grid stabilisation and storage, high voltage switchgears and transformers, and digital grid technology.
As the United Kingdom continues to prioritise its commitment to renewable energy, there is an increasing need for a significant expansion of its electricity transmission network. Renewable energy, including wind, solar, and hydropower, provides a cleaner and more sustainable alternative to fossil fuels. However, harnessing these energy sources often requires expansive infrastructure, like wind which are typically located in remote areas away from urban centres where energy demand is highest. To deliver this power effectively to where it's needed, Britain's electricity transmission network must be expanded and upgraded.
This position is situated within a team of engineers which specialises in Grid Access and HVDC Converter station electrical transmission projects. The team is composed of multifaceted talents, including dedicated Project Managers, Design Engineers, and Digital Engineers. They operate across civil and structural engineering and building services disciplines. Collaboratively, this team designs and implements coordinated solutions to establish the essential infrastructure needed for the installation and operation of high voltage electrical transmission systems.
